国产精品1024永久观看,大尺度欧美暖暖视频在线观看,亚洲宅男精品一区在线观看,欧美日韩一区二区三区视频,2021中文字幕在线观看

  • <option id="fbvk0"></option>
    1. <rt id="fbvk0"><tr id="fbvk0"></tr></rt>
      <center id="fbvk0"><optgroup id="fbvk0"></optgroup></center>
      <center id="fbvk0"></center>

      <li id="fbvk0"><abbr id="fbvk0"><dl id="fbvk0"></dl></abbr></li>

      變更鍵盤裝置的注冊碼的方法

      文檔序號:8412100閱讀:285來源:國知局
      變更鍵盤裝置的注冊碼的方法
      【技術(shù)領(lǐng)域】
      [0001]本發(fā)明涉及一種鍵盤裝置的操作方法,尤其是指一種變更鍵盤裝置的注冊碼的方法。
      【背景技術(shù)】
      [0002]根據(jù)USB開發(fā)者論壇(USB IF)所制定的USB標準規(guī)范所規(guī)定的,任何以USB規(guī)格作為信息傳輸媒介的外接裝置都必需具有一制造商注冊碼(Vendor ID, VID)以及一裝置標識符(Product ID, PID),以讓一信息主機可以通過該制造商注冊碼以及該裝置標識符分辨每一個外接裝置。該制造商注冊碼需由該外接裝置的制造商向該USB開發(fā)者論壇申請,以獲取代表該制造商的制造商注冊碼,而該裝置標識符則是由該制造商決定,也就是說,該制造商可以依據(jù)每一個外接裝置的差異,針對每一個外接裝置設(shè)定不同的裝置標識符。
      [0003]其中,仍以鍵盤裝置進行舉例,當該鍵盤裝置制造完成時,該制造商注冊碼及該裝置標識符便無法更改,假如存儲有該制造商注冊碼及該裝置標識符的存儲單元發(fā)生了數(shù)據(jù)上的損毀,導致該制造商注冊碼或該裝置標識符無法完整或順利的讀出,使得該信息裝置無法順利地辨識該鍵盤裝置,而使得該鍵盤裝置無法正常地使用。除此之外,特定行業(yè)從業(yè)人員所開發(fā)的操作系統(tǒng)會對每一個外接裝置的該制造商注冊碼及該裝置標識符進行驗證,如果該外接裝置所具有的制造商注冊碼或裝置標識符無法通過該操作系統(tǒng)的驗證時,該外接裝置將有可能無法正常的運作。

      【發(fā)明內(nèi)容】

      [0004]本發(fā)明的主要目的在于解決現(xiàn)在所使用的鍵盤裝置在制造完成后無法變更制造商注冊碼及裝置標識符的問題。
      [0005]為了達到上述目的,本發(fā)明提供了一種變更鍵盤裝置的注冊碼的方法,該鍵盤裝置包括有一鍵盤控制單元以及多個分別連接至該鍵盤控制單元并且經(jīng)按壓可向該鍵盤控制單元輸出一按鍵信號的按鍵,該鍵盤控制單元存儲有一制造商注冊碼和一裝置標識符,該方法包括有以下步驟:步驟一:設(shè)定該鍵盤控制單元以具有一注冊碼轉(zhuǎn)換模式,并令該注冊碼轉(zhuǎn)換模式以至少一個按鍵經(jīng)按壓所輸出的該按鍵信號為一啟動條件;步驟二:利用該鍵盤控制單元常態(tài)判斷每一個按鍵所輸出的按鍵信號是否符合啟動條件,若是,即令該鍵盤控制單元進入該注冊碼轉(zhuǎn)換模式;步驟三:在該注冊碼轉(zhuǎn)換模式下,利用該鍵盤控制單元依次接收每一個按鍵經(jīng)按壓所輸出的按鍵信號,并將該多個按鍵信號存儲記錄為一變更后的制造商注冊碼或一變更后的裝置標識符,覆蓋該鍵盤控制單元原先存儲的制造商注冊碼或裝置標識符,最后令該鍵盤控制單元跳出該注冊碼轉(zhuǎn)換模式。
      [0006]在一實施例中,在該步驟一中所述的該注冊碼轉(zhuǎn)換模式可進一步以多個按鍵所組成的一按鍵組合為啟動條件。
      [0007]在一實施例中,在該步驟三的實施過程中,該鍵盤控制單元將接收到的這些按鍵信號先記錄為該變更后的制造商注冊碼,當完成對該變更后的制造商注冊碼的記錄后,將隨后所接收到的這些按鍵信號記錄為該變更后的裝置標識符。
      [0008]在一實施例中,在該步驟三的實施過程中,該鍵盤控制單元將接收到的這些按鍵信號先記錄為該變更后的裝置標識符,當完成對該變更后的裝置標識符的記錄后,將隨后所接收到的這些按鍵信號記錄為該變更后的制造商注冊碼。
      [0009]在一實施例中,該步驟一還包括有一設(shè)定該注冊碼轉(zhuǎn)換模式以至少一個按鍵所輸出的按鍵信號為一完成設(shè)定條件的子步驟,該步驟三還包括有當在該鍵盤控制單元中使用該變更后的制造商注冊碼或該變更后的裝置標識符覆蓋制造商注冊碼或裝置標識符后,利用該鍵盤控制單元判斷所接收的該按鍵信號是否符合該完成設(shè)定條件,若是,即結(jié)束設(shè)定,跳出該注冊碼轉(zhuǎn)換模式的子步驟。
      [0010]在一實施例中,該注冊碼轉(zhuǎn)換模式可進一步以多個按鍵所組成的一按鍵組合為該完成設(shè)定條件。
      [0011]在一實施例中,該鍵盤裝置還具有一與該鍵盤控制單元相連接并且當該鍵盤裝置進入該注冊碼轉(zhuǎn)換模式時顯示該鍵盤控制單元所接收的每一個按鍵信號的顯示模塊。
      [0012]在一實施例中,該步驟一中所述的該注冊碼轉(zhuǎn)換模式是以程序指令的樣式被記錄在該鍵盤控制單元上。
      [0013]通過本發(fā)明的上述方法,與現(xiàn)在所使用的方法相比具有以下功效:
      [0014]1.本發(fā)明方法的實施,使得該鍵盤裝置被制造完成后,仍可針對該制造商注冊碼及該裝置標識符進行修改,大幅改善了現(xiàn)在所使用的鍵盤裝置無法更改制造商注冊碼及裝置標識符而導致該鍵盤裝置無法正常工作的問題。
      【附圖說明】
      [0015]圖1為本發(fā)明變更鍵盤裝置的注冊碼的方法的鍵盤裝置的外觀示意圖。
      [0016]圖2為本發(fā)明變更鍵盤裝置的注冊碼的方法的第一實施例的方法流程圖。
      [0017]圖3為本發(fā)明變更鍵盤裝置的注冊碼的方法的第二實施例的方法流程圖。
      [0018]圖4為本發(fā)明變更鍵盤裝置的注冊碼的方法的第三實施例的方法流程圖。
      [0019]圖5為本發(fā)明變更鍵盤裝置的注冊碼的方法的第四實施例的方法流程圖。
      [0020]圖6為本發(fā)明變更鍵盤裝置的注冊碼的方法的第五實施例的鍵盤裝置的外觀示意圖。
      【具體實施方式】
      [0021]現(xiàn)在參閱附圖對涉及本發(fā)明的詳細說明及技術(shù)內(nèi)容說明如下:
      [0022]請參閱圖1,本發(fā)明的變更鍵盤裝置的注冊碼的方法被應(yīng)用在一鍵盤裝置I上,該鍵盤裝置I包括:一鍵盤控制單元11以及多個分別連接至該鍵盤控制單元11并經(jīng)按壓向該鍵盤控制單元11輸出一按鍵信號的按鍵12。更進一步地,這些按鍵12是依據(jù)一鍵盤信號的矩陣電路布局分別相應(yīng)地設(shè)置在該鍵盤裝置I的一電路板(本圖中未示出)上,而所謂的該鍵盤信號的矩陣電路具有多個分別表示該鍵盤信號的電性接點,而這些按鍵12被設(shè)置為分別對應(yīng)于這些電性接點。當該鍵盤裝置I操作時,該鍵盤控制單元11會掃描該矩陣電路,并獲取經(jīng)觸發(fā)的其中一個電性接點所輸出的電氣信號,進而與此電氣信號進行比對而輸出該按鍵信號。此外,本發(fā)明的鍵盤控制單元11還存儲有一制造商注冊碼(VID)以及一裝置標識符(PID),該制造商注冊碼以及該裝置標識符可以存儲在該鍵盤控制單元11的一啟動碼(Bootcode)中,或者是存儲在該鍵盤控制單元11所連接的一存儲單元中,而該存儲單元可以是一電可擦除可編程只讀存儲器(EEPROM)或一閃存(Flash)。該制造商注冊碼與該裝置標識符可為一由多個字元碼所組成的信息碼。
      [0023]請同時參閱圖1和圖2,本發(fā)明的方法包括有以下步驟:步驟一(S01):設(shè)定該鍵盤控制單元11以具有一注冊碼轉(zhuǎn)換模式,并令該注冊碼轉(zhuǎn)換模式以至少一個按鍵12經(jīng)按壓所輸出的該按鍵信號為一啟動條件;步驟二(S02):利用該鍵盤控制單元11常態(tài)判斷每一個按鍵12所輸出的該鍵盤信號是否符合該啟動條件,若是,即令該鍵盤控制單元11進入該注冊碼轉(zhuǎn)換模式;步驟三(S03):在該注冊碼轉(zhuǎn)換模式下,利用該鍵盤控制單元11依次接收每一個按鍵12經(jīng)按壓所輸出的鍵盤信號,并將這些鍵盤信號將記錄存儲為一變更后的制造商注冊碼或一變更后的裝置標識符,覆蓋該鍵盤控制單元11原先存儲的該制造商注冊碼或該裝置標識符,最后令該鍵盤控制單元11跳出該注冊碼轉(zhuǎn)換模式。
      [0024]更進一步地說明,該步驟一(SOl)主要是提供了具有該注冊碼轉(zhuǎn)換模式的該鍵盤裝置1,該注冊碼轉(zhuǎn)換模式進一步建構(gòu)于該鍵盤控制單元11的一程序指令,其主要用于變更該鍵盤控制單元11所存儲的該制造商注冊碼與該裝置標識符,而該注冊碼轉(zhuǎn)換模式是以這些按鍵12所輸出的這些按鍵信號中的一個作為該啟動條件。為了能夠清楚解釋本發(fā)明的該啟動條件,在此實施例中假設(shè)該鍵盤裝置I具有一啟動按鍵121,而該啟動按鍵121輸出的鍵盤信號被設(shè)定為該注冊碼轉(zhuǎn)換模式的啟動條件,也就是說,當該啟動按鍵121經(jīng)按壓輸出該鍵盤信號時,該鍵盤控制單元11判斷符合該啟動條件即會令該鍵盤裝置I進入該注冊碼轉(zhuǎn)換模式。此外,本實施例是以單一按鍵(該啟動按鍵121)進行舉例,但本發(fā)明方法并不限于此,亦可進一步以多個按鍵12所組成的一按鍵組合作為該啟動條件,也就是說,使用者需要同時按壓兩個以上的按鍵12才可進入該注冊碼轉(zhuǎn)換模式,該按鍵組合可以是由這些按鍵12中的一功能切換鍵(Fn_key)搭配另一按鍵(Fl?F9)或一數(shù)字鍵組成。另外,本發(fā)明實施例在前述實施例中,是以設(shè)置該啟動按鍵121或以該按鍵組合作為該注冊碼轉(zhuǎn)換模式的該啟動條件,但本發(fā)明也可利
      當前第1頁1 2 
      網(wǎng)友詢問留言 已有0條留言
      • 還沒有人留言評論。精彩留言會獲得點贊!
      1